Facts about Factoryville, PA

Factoryville is a borough in Wyoming County, Pennsylvania, United States. The population was 1,292 in 2019. Factoryville was named for a woolen factory near the original town site.

The second Saturday in August every year is recognized as a holiday in Factoryville. Christy Mathewson Day celebrates the baseball Hall-of-Famer who was born in Factoryville on August 12, 1880. The festivities include a parade from Keystone College to Christy Mathewson Park, a 6 km foot race (in honor of Mathewson’s nickname, “The Big 6”), a chicken barbecue, games and many other activities.

Things To Do in and around Factoryville, PA

If you’re looking for houses for sale in Factoryville, PA, you’ll be pleased to know that there are a wealth of things to do while living here, including:

  • Lake Winola: Lake Winola is located in the Endless Mountains in Northeastern Pennsylvania. This spring-fed lake is named after the “water lily” and can be traced to Native Americans, who were its first residents. The Scranton, Montrose, and Binghamton Railroad, also known as the Northern Electric Trolley Line, built a branch line from Factoryville to Lake Winola, which opened in May 1908. Lake Winola has been and continues to be a popular summer spot for vacationers from Scranton and other surrounding communities since the early 1900s.
  • Little Rocky Glen: This nature preserve, though somewhat diminutive, is big on beauty. It’s a great place to rest and take in the sights and sounds of nature. It’s owned and protected by the Countryside Conservancy and it encompasses a shale and sandstone gorge, about one hundred feet deep. Located just off Route 6, along Lithia Valley Road. Trails lead from the parking lot to cliffs overlooking the glen and down to a bottom pool and a picnic pavilion.
  • Countryside Conservancy Trolley Trail: This segment of the trail passes through town and behind Keystone College’s campus. Take a walk or bike ride on this 1.7-mile stretch along the old Northern Electric Trolley railbed. Close-by one can appreciate a day at Christy Mathewson Park and Creekside Park.
  • Lake Sheridan: Although this lake is about half the size of Lake Winola, it’s a great place to enjoy the summer, fishing, fireworks and more. It’s located on Route 107 between Factoryville and Fleetville.
  • Stone Hedge Golf Course: A great place to play a round of golf, have a bite to eat or experience arguably the area’s finest Christmas light display, the Festival of Lights.
  • Nicholson Bridge: With 167,000 cubic yards of concrete, the Tunkhannock Creek Viaduct, which finished completion in 1915, still remains the world’s largest concrete bridge. Did you know former President Theodore Roosevelt, Thomas Edison and Henry Ford all came to visit this wonder of the world? Stop by today and check out this one-of-a-kind bridge.

School Districts in Factoryville, PA

The Lackawanna Trail School District is a public Pennsylvania school district. It serves Nicholson Borough, Nicholson Township, Clinton Township and Factoryville Borough in Wyoming County and Dalton Borough, La Plume Township, Benton Township and West Abington Township in Lackawanna County. The school district encompasses approximately 72.43 square miles and serves a resident population of 8,671. The district has one (K-6) elementary school located on College Avenue, Factoryville and one (7-12) high school on Tunnel Hill Road, Factoryville.

Where is Factoryville, PA?

Factoryville is a charming borough located in Wyoming County in the northeastern region of Pennsylvania, just north of the Abingtons. It is situated in the picturesque Endless Mountain region and offers plenty of scenic views to explore. The town is located approximately 40 miles from the New York-New Jersey border.
